A leading retail company in Greater London is seeking a passionate Part-time Fragrance Sales Consultant for Heathrow Terminal 4. The role involves selling fragrance and beauty products, providing outstanding customer service, and achieving sales targets in a dynamic retail environment.
Applicants should have sales experience in a similar industry and a passion for luxury brands. The position offers a starting salary of £10,920 annually plus commission, as well as various employee benefits.

How to prepare for a job interview at Aspects Beauty Company
✨Know Your Fragrances
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of different fragrance families and luxury brands. Being able to discuss popular scents and their notes will show your passion for the industry and impress the interviewers.
✨Showcase Your Sales Skills
Prepare specific examples from your past sales experience that highlight your ability to meet targets and provide excellent customer service.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ses effectively.
✨Dress to Impress
Since this role is in the luxury retail sector, make sure you dress smartly and professionally. Your appearance should reflect the brand's image, so opt for a polished look that aligns with the high-end products you'll be selling.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the company and the role. This shows your genuine interest and helps you understand if the company culture aligns with your values. Ask about their approach to customer service or how they support their staff in achieving sales targets.
